Career path

Career Role (Public Health Policy & Social Determinants) Description
Public Health Analyst Analyze health data, identify trends, and advise on policy. High demand for data analysis skills.
Health Policy Researcher Conduct research on the impact of social determinants on health outcomes. Strong research and writing skills essential.
Health Policy Consultant Advise government and organizations on public health policy. Excellent communication and strategic thinking skills required.
Social Determinants of Health Program Manager Oversee programs addressing social determinants. Proven project management and community engagement skills crucial.
Health Equity Specialist Work to reduce health disparities and promote equity. Requires strong understanding of social determinants and advocacy skills.

A Graduate Certificate in Public Health Policy and Social Determinants is increasingly significant in today's UK market. The nation faces pressing health inequalities, with stark disparities impacting various communities. For instance, Public Health England data reveals significant variations in life expectancy across different regions. This necessitates professionals equipped to navigate complex policy landscapes and address the social determinants of health, such as poverty, education, and access to healthcare.

Understanding the interplay between policy and these social factors is crucial. The certificate equips graduates with the skills to analyze health data, design effective interventions, and advocate for equitable healthcare access. Public health policy professionals with this specialized knowledge are highly sought after, reflecting growing industry demand for expertise in tackling these challenges.
